Dental implants have turn into a preferred solution for individuals seeking to exchange missing teeth, providing performance that carefully resembles natural teeth (Implants Dental Implants Walker MI). However, some sufferers report experiencing headaches following the procedure. This raises the question: can dental implants cause headaches?


The relationship between dental procedures and headaches is complicated. While dental implants themselves usually are not instantly related to headaches, a quantity of elements might contribute to this discomfort. Stress and nervousness related to the surgery can lead to tension within the neck and jaw, leading to headaches.


Following the process, people may expertise discomfort within the surgical area. This discomfort can radiate, leading to referred pain that manifests as a headache. The body’s healing course of places extra stress on surrounding muscular tissues and tissues, exacerbating the scenario.

Misalignment of the chew may contribute to headaches post-implant. When implants are incorrectly placed, it could lead to an altered chunk. This misalignment forces the jaw muscular tissues to work harder, inserting added strain on the head and neck, which can result in tension headaches.


In some situations, sufferers may develop bruxism, or teeth grinding, following dental implant surgery. The discomfort from the implant might set off anxiousness, leading to teeth grinding during sleep. This exercise can significantly pressure muscles in the jaw, neck, and temples, leading to frequent headaches.


Sinus points could arise after implant placement, particularly if implants are inserted in the higher jaw. If the implant extends into or close to the sinus cavity, it may irritate sinus tissues, causing sinus stress and headaches. This may be mistaken for headaches originating from other medical conditions.

Another consideration is the affect of improper fitting of dental crowns placed on implants. If a crown doesn't match well, it could place undue pressure on surrounding teeth and buildings within the mouth. This stress can lead to muscle fatigue, which may current as headaches.


Some individuals may also experience a condition generally known as temperomandibular joint disorder (TMJ) after receiving dental implants. TMJ can create discomfort that spreads to the head, inflicting pressure headaches. Patients may be unaware they've TMJ, attributing their pain solely to the dental procedures they underwent.


Anxiety about dental work also can have physical manifestations. High levels of anxiety may result in muscle pressure in varied areas of the body, together with the neck and shoulders. This pressure can typically trigger headaches, marking a cyclical issue for those apprehensive about dental work.


Effective communication with the dental skilled pre- and post-surgery is essential. Patients should express any concerns or ongoing discomfort after the process, which might assist in identifying the root causes of headaches. A thorough analysis might help the dentist tackle any complications arising from the implant placement.

    Can dental implants cause headaches?



What are the frequent causes of headaches after getting dental implants?undefinedHeadaches after dental implant placement may end up from varied factors similar to jaw tension, improper chew alignment, or infection. These points can strain the encompassing muscles and nerves, leading to discomfort.


Is it regular to experience headaches after dental implant surgery?undefinedWhile some discomfort is predicted within the post-operative phase, persistent headaches aren't typical. If headaches proceed, it's essential to consult with your dentist to rule out problems.


Can the position of dental implants lead to nerve damage?undefinedYes, improper placement of implants can probably injury close by nerves, which may end in headaches. A expert dental skilled minimizes this risk through cautious planning and imaging techniques.

How long do headaches sometimes last after dental implant surgery?undefinedHeadaches should subside as therapeutic progresses, usually within a number of days to per week. If headaches persist past this period, seek the advice of your dentist for an analysis.


What should I do if I experience headaches after getting dental implants?undefinedIf headaches happen, maintain a record of their depth, period, and associated signs. Contact your dentist for an assessment to determine if additional intervention is important.


Are there preventative measures to avoid headaches when getting dental implants?undefinedTo decrease the danger of headaches, make sure you select an experienced dental surgeon and observe all pre- and post-operative instructions. Proper bite alignment must also be evaluated through the restoration phase.


Can dental implants affect my bite and trigger headaches?undefinedYes, if the dental implants alter your chew improperly, it could result in muscle strain and resultant headaches. Regular follow-ups along with your dentist might help appropriate any bite-related issues promptly.

When ought to I be involved about headaches post-implant surgery?undefinedIf headaches are severe, persistent, or accompanied by other symptoms like swelling, fever, or discharge, contact your dentist instantly, as these might sign an infection or different complications.


Are there alternative treatments if dental implants are causing headaches?undefinedIf dental implants are linked to your headaches, options similar to adjusting the chew, dental evening guards, and even pain management methods could additionally be considered. Consultation with your dentist may help determine the best plan of action.
